Transaction f29ffbbfe4d996cf5129eb89fe3abc7412ecb69b64999a785f40e745b013bf2c

1 Input
2 Outputs
  • f29ffbbfe4d996cf5129eb89fe3abc7412ecb69b64999a785f40e745b013bf2c:0
  • value  6713
    address  mu6ehnjruTVhNa8oRot9AFEkbRPfm1gdsL
  • f29ffbbfe4d996cf5129eb89fe3abc7412ecb69b64999a785f40e745b013bf2c:1
  • value  198397912714
    address  2MtWLqg2M471Sos6GsRCmxdtgWHaYUGGYEe